首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 网站开发 > asp.net >

asp.net 在登录界面下判断是否存在数据库DB_Happy, 急

2012-09-06 
asp.net 在登录界面上判断是否存在数据库DB_Happy,急 急 急asp。net在登录界面上判断是否存在数据库DB_Happ

asp.net 在登录界面上判断是否存在数据库DB_Happy,急 急 急
asp。net在登录界面上判断是否存在数据库DB_Happy 如果有的话就不用再附加了, 如果没有则附加一个数据库DB_Happy


请大家把代码写的详细一点,如果有用马上给分! 谢谢了

[解决办法]
string str = "select name from sysdatabases WHERE name='RfIDMeeting'";
SqlCommand myCommand = new SqlCommand(str, myConn);
string haha = Convert.ToString(myCommand.ExecuteScalar());
if (haha != "RfIDMeeting") //不存在数据库
{
//str = "IF EXISTS (SELECT name FROM master.dbo.sysdatabases WHERE name = N'" + DbName + "')" + "beginEXEC sp_detach_db " + DbName + " end " + "EXEC sp_attach_db @dbname ='MarryHappy',@filename1=N'" + strMdf + "',@filename2=N'" + strLdf + "'";
str = "EXEC sp_attach_db @dbname ='RfIDMeeting',@filename1=N'" + strMdf + "',@filename2=N'" + strLdf + "'";
myCommand = new SqlCommand(str, myConn);
myCommand.ExecuteNonQuery();
}


照这种方式改你要的代码就可以了

热点排行